Output 56a9b798652b3b338ef9a26d66fb4e32e5e05617d69dbc7005f00553b78693e8:1

value
2690600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f007a0377ac1356f2e2111b973cfdc75e5267cb OP_EQUAL
address
3Ej986FTsh4mbFs5F1LSWDdsfkMMrmBnjL
transaction
56a9b798652b3b338ef9a26d66fb4e32e5e05617d69dbc7005f00553b78693e8
confirmations
382146
spent
true